Modern Materials That Catch Light Like Real Enamel

The reason cosmetic dentistry looks so much better than it did a decade ago is the materials. We layer modern composites in multiple translucencies so a bonded tooth refracts light the same way the tooth next to it does — no flat, white, "veneer-y" look. For lab-fabricated work we use lithium disilicate (e.max) porcelain, which is both strong and lifelike. The right material depends on what we're fixing: composite for single chips and gaps, porcelain for length, shape, and longevity.

Should I get veneers or bonding for a chipped front tooth?

For a single small chip, bonding is usually the smarter call — one visit, lower cost, and we don't have to remove much of your real tooth. Porcelain veneers make more sense if you want to change the shape, length, or color of multiple front teeth at once and want a result that resists staining and lasts longer. How long do cosmetic dental results last?

Whitening typically lasts one to two years before a touch-up. Composite bonding lasts five to seven years on average. Porcelain veneers and crowns often last ten to fifteen years or longer with good care. Avoiding chewing ice, wearing a custom bite guard if you grind, and keeping up regular cleanings all extend the life of cosmetic work.
